The cost of living in Kumasi is 17% less expensive than in N'Djamena. Cities ranked 8911th and 8498th ($416 vs $501) in the list of the most expensive cities in the world and ranked 9th and 1st in Ghana and Chad, respectively. Check Ghana vs Chad comparison.

The average after-tax salary is enough to cover living expenses for 0.4 months in Kumasi compared to 0.7 months in N'Djamena. Kumasi ranked 4th best city to live in Ghana vs N'Djamena ranked 1st in Chad, while ranked 7622nd and 9237th among best cities to live in the world.
